EDAN said:
As you should know the $200 Apex 460 is the same mic as the $1,400 Telefunken M16 ...It's an awsome mic and most would agree worth the $1,400 Telefunken sells it for.

...the original Tele M16 (model MK-I) started life the same as the Apex but received multiple upgrades (caps, tube, etc) which make it well worth the price of a modestly-modded $200 mic...hardly anything in the realm of $1400 :eek: ...thus Tele discontinued that version (justifiably so...the newer MK-II is totally redesigned rather simply modded):
